Nach Aufruf dieses Menübefehls können in einem Dialog die Optionen für die Suche nach bestimmten Elementen/Attributen angegeben werden. Sind diese Elemente/Attribute vorhanden, so wird eine Ergebnisliste generiert. Die einzelnen Fundstellen können in der Ergebnisliste per Mausklick ausgewählt werden und das entsprechende Element/Attribut wird in der XML-Strukturansicht bzw. auf der Dokumentseite markiert.
Wird die Ergebnisliste nicht mehr benötigt, kann diese über den Button Ergebnisliste schließen wieder geschlossen werden. Die geöffnete Ergebnisliste wird bei Änderungen der XML-Struktur nicht automatisch aktualisiert (aus "Performance-Gründen" nicht möglich; d.h. es würden sich lange Wartezeiten ergeben). Bei Änderungen der XML-Struktur muss der Dialog zur Suche von XML-Elementen neu aufgerufen werden und die Ergebnisliste wird nach Bestätigung des Elemente suchen-Buttons neu generiert.
Folgende Suchoptionen stehen zur Verfügung:
Elementname: Suche nach einem bestimmten im Dokument verwendeten XML-Element oder nach einem beliebigen Element (im Dropdownmenü: [Beliebiges Element])
Elementtext: Suche nach einem bestimmten Text im Inhalt eines Elements (Textknoten)
Modifizierbar über das linke Dropdownmenü: enthält, ist gleich, ist ungleich
Attributname: Suche nach einem bestimmten Attribut. Der Name des Attributs muss in diesem Feld eingegeben werden.
Attributwert: Suche nach einem bestimmten Attributwert. Modifizierbar über das linke Dropdownmenü: enthält, ist gleich, ist ungleich.
Dialog: XML-Elemente suchen
Ergebnisliste der XML-Elemente-Suche
Beispiele für mögliche Suchoptionen zum Auffinden von XML-Elementen/Attributen:
Suchoptionen, um alle Leseproben-Kapitel zu finden
Suchoptionen, um alle u1-Elemente mit @typ="1"
-Attribut zu finden
Suchoptionen, um alle <zwischentitel1>
-Elemente zu finden, die den Text "und" enthalten
Suchoptionen, um alle Verweise mit Attribut @verweis-intern
zu finden
Suchoptionen, um ein Verweisziel (Element mit Attribut @id
und Attributwert aus dem Attribut @verweis-intern
des Elements <verweis>
) zu einem bestimmten Verweis zu finden
Suchoptionen, um alle Einschub1-Zwischentitel (<einschub1_zwischentitel>
) mit dem Attribut @typ
und dem Attributwert = "2" zu finden.